Window Tinting Laws in maryland

Front Windshield:Non-reflective tint above AS-1 line
Front Side Windows:Must allow 70% of light to pass through
Back Side Windows:Must allow 35% of light to pass through
Rear Window:Must allow 35% of light to pass through
Maryland car window tinting laws require front side, back side, and rear windows to have at least 35% VLT (Visible Light Transmission). Windshield tint is restricted to the top 5 inches. Window film reflectivity cannot exceed 35%. Maryland enforces these regulations to maintain visibility standards for safety. Professional window tinting services ensure legal compliance while providing UV protection and heat reduction for the variable mid-Atlantic climate.

How much does car window tinting cost?

The average cost to tint car windows in Maryland ranges from $200-$450 for a full vehicle. Standard car window tinting prices start around $200-$300, while premium ceramic tints cost $350-$450. Single window installation averages $55-$85. Maryland pricing for window tint for cars varies between Baltimore/DC suburbs and more rural areas, with urban installations commanding higher prices. Vehicle size impacts the final cost, with larger vehicles adding $30-$75 to the total. Most car window tinting services in Maryland provide documentation certifying compliance with state regulations. When comparing options, ask about the installer's certification and experience level.
